Reading notes

  • Index, currency, rate and Bitcoin lines come from the CFTC Traders in Financial Futures (TFF) report (Asset Managers, Leveraged Funds).
  • Gold and Crude Oil come from the Disaggregated report. There is no Asset Manager category for physical commodities, so Swap Dealers is shown as the institutional proxy and Managed Money is the speculative side.
  • A net long figure on its own is not a signal. Look at the change versus the prior week, the trend over several weeks, and the size relative to open interest before drawing any conclusion.
